Disconnect Between Educator Perceptions and Learner Diversity

1. Personal Experience: Segregated Backgrounds


Meier and Hartell's work emphasizes that many educators came from and were trained in

segregated backgrounds (Source 1.1).


 Limited Cultural Knowledge: Educators' personal experiences were largely confined to

their own social, cultural, and racial groups. When they were "propelled... into teaching

learners from different racially diverse backgrounds" (Source 1.1), they often lacked the

necessary cultural knowledge and exposure to understand the diverse students in their

classrooms (Source 1.7).
